Read the Whipme fine print carefully: you must be licenced to purchase the R134 as well as any other refrigerant.

> I purchased a 87 Westy in January and have since resealed the heads and the > other expectec vanagon "maintenance". The PO said the AC was not operational > but"just needed to be charged." My original plan was to take it to a AC > specialist, have them pressure test and diagnose any problems and order parts > from the Bus Depot if any are needed. > However...What do I see on the back page of the 135th catalog JC Whipme has > sent this year...A Do-It-Yourself R-134a conversion kit for only > $49.95....Includes- Service port adapters, 3 12oz cans of R134a, 1 8 1/2oz > can of ester oil charge "O" ring conditioner, a retrofit label, and a can of > stop leak and detector. > I know from the archives that some have made the switch but I welcome any > comments, flames, threats etc. Sound Do-able??? I am considering this swap > more on the availability of "Freon at free market prices" than any perceived > or otherwise environmental threat. > Don > York, PA >
